Practice Manager (12-month FTC) – Salary up to £40,000 DOE
Closing Date: 16th July 2026 (subject to change)
At Inspiring Vet Care
Our people are at the heart of everything we do. As the UK’s number one vet care provider, we deliver care to over 2 million animals, promoting healthier animals and happier owners. Avon Lodge Vets, part of inspiring vet care, is seeking a Practice Manager on a 12-month fixed-term contract to lead operational and administrative functions at our Wells Road and Bishopsworth Practices in Bristol.
This is an exceptional opportunity for a proactive manager who thrives in a team environment, supporting both people and processes to deliver outstanding patient and client care.
Key Responsibilities
Working closely with the Director of Practice & Clinical Services, Head Nurse, and Head Receptionist, you will:
Core Operational Leadership
- Oversee day-to-day administration and operational management of the practice
- Enhance team performance, service quality, and an outstanding client experience
- Foster a positive, culture-driven workplace for colleagues and clients

People & Team Management
- Manage payroll, staff rotas, annual leave, and workforce scheduling
- Recruitment support: Advertise vacancies, conduct interviews, and manage onboarding/induction
- Lead employee engagement, performance management, and staff development
- Handle process changes and support efficiency improvements
Compliance & Performance Management
-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) and business goals
- Ensure adherence to company policies (e.g., health & safety) and regulatory requirements (e.g., RCVS accreditation)
- Manage client feedback and complaints
Qualities You’ll Bring
We’re looking for a senior operations manager with: ✔ Proven people and process management experience, ideally in healthcare, veterinary, or customer-service sectors ✔ Strong people leadership skills, including performance management and team development ✔ Exceptional organisational abilities to balance competing priorities ✔ Conflict resolution and change management experience ✔ Stakeholder engagement and communication expertise
